Owner’s Engineering and support during the pre-FID engineering phase (FEL3) for a new 20 million gallons per year Renewable Fuel Oil Production Facility.
Front end engineering design and technology trials support for a liquor coproduct contaminant reduction system at an existing 30TPD ag-based pulp mill.
Heat and Material Balance (HMB) study and preliminary vendor engagement for a 9 MW biomass-to-power generation facility utilizing gasification to produce syngas and biochar, coupled with an ORC system for power generation.

Isomer completed project technical and financial due diligence on a series of 19 projects producing renewable natural gas (RNG) from anaerobic digestion to support a private equity firm.
Multi-discipline front-end engineering and estimating services for a facility using a proprietary process to convert waste cellulose into consumer product replacements.
Front-end engineering services for a pelletized corn stover feedstock facility supporting sustainable aviation fuel production, including material balance development, high-level equipment sizing, and a feasibility-level site layout.
